^ It’s the period just after that when the team seems to travel from one misty, spooky locale to another encountering things like curses and ghosts and witches. It runs from roughly issue #s 32-43 and also includes a team-up with Superman in World’s Finest.

Mal and Lilith were featured prominently during this period and they’re two of my faves. Nick Cardy also handled most of the art chores on these issues so you know they’ll look great.
